The Role: As the Customer Service Representative, you will provide courteous, friendly and efficient customer service to all customers and effectively manage the order book to enable the company to meet its sales targets. You will develop a close working relationship with Account Managers to ensure accurate and timely order placement, management and shipment. You will look after a number of our independent accounts, overseeing orders from start to finish, anticipating problems and troubleshooting accordingly. The ideal candidate will have an eye for detail and enjoy working directly with customers. You will be motivated by achieving dual goals of keeping customers satisfied and enabling the company to meet its sales targets. Fluency in English, French and German is required for this role.
Your Impact:
- Responsible for all order entry and order modifications for own account base
- Communicate with sales force and customers to ensure smooth operation of order flow
- Expedite customer orders, including keeping them informed of delays or early fulfilment
- Follow up on outstanding orders/availability issues to minimise cancellations
- Liaise with Credit team when necessary on any order held relating to credit issues
- Provide excellent after‑sales service, by dealing with returns and credits in a timely and effective manner
- Report on a daily, weekly and monthly basis to give clear picture of the status of account base
